Who will be able to grant permissions in the future?  When we needed access to the glast and glastraw accounts, Tom Glanzman provided it.  For the glastops account, he had Steve Tether do it. 

  There are a number of different types of permissions to consider.  Access to the glast and glastraw accounts, i.e., login privilege, is granted by AFS groups.  (See AFS Group Structure and Ownership Hierarchy for details).  Currently, there are four individuals who can modify the 'login' privileges: richard, tonyj, dragon, heather.  This list could potentially be expanded in the future.
